EXCEL矩阵函数,矩阵函数变换

2025-06-18 19:02:19 函数指令 嘉兴
  1. EXCEL矩阵函数
  2. 矩阵化为对角矩阵技巧
  3. matlab如何将普通矩阵转化为正互反

EXCEL矩阵函数

在excel中使用矩阵函数:

1.矩阵乘法运算,选择G3:H4,输入公式:=MMULT(A3:B4,D3:E4) 按Ctrl+Shift+Enter键,即输入数组公式。

EXCEL矩阵函数,矩阵函数变换

2.求矩阵的逆矩阵,选择A7:B8,输入公式:=MINVERSE(A3:B4) 按Ctrl+Shift+Enter键,即输入数组公式。

3.求矩阵的中值,选择单元格D7,输入公式:=MDETERM(A3:B4)

矩阵化为对角矩阵技巧

1,求出一个矩阵的全部互异的特征值a1,a2……

2,对每个特征值,求特征矩阵a1I-A的秩,判断每个特征值的几何重数q=n-r(a1I-A),是否等于它的代数重数p,只要有一个不相等,A就不可 以相似对角化,否则, 就可以相似对角化

EXCEL矩阵函数,矩阵函数变换

3,当可以相似对角化时,对每个特征值,求方程组,(aiI-A)X=0的一个基础解系

4,令P=这些基础解系,则P-1AP=diag(a1,a2,a3……),其中有qi个特征值

矩阵对角化的条件:有个线性无关的特征向量,可对角化矩阵是线性代数和矩阵论中重要的一类矩阵。如果一个方块矩阵A相似于对角矩阵,也就是说,如果存在一个可逆矩阵P使得P−1AP是对角矩阵,则它就被称为可对角化的。

如果V是有限维度的向量空间,则线性映射T:V→V被称为可对角化的,如果存在V的一个基,T关于它可被表示为对角矩阵。对角化是找到可对角化矩阵或映射的相应对角矩阵的过程。

EXCEL矩阵函数,矩阵函数变换

可对角化矩阵和映射在线性代数中有重要价值,因为对角矩阵特别容易处理:它们的特征值和特征向量是已知的,并通过简单的提升对角元素到同样的幂来把一个矩阵提升为它的幂。

假设矩阵为A,则充要条件为: 1)A有n个线性无关的特征向量. 2)A的极小多项式没有重根. 充分非必要条件: 1)A没有重特征值 2)A*A^H=A^H*A 必要非充分条件: f(A)可对角化,其中f是收敛半径大于A的谱半径的任何解析函数 拓展资料 1、如果这个矩阵可以化为对角矩阵的话那求特征值吧,它的特征值就是对角矩阵的元素,前提是该矩阵是可化为对角矩阵的,如果是对称矩阵,那对称矩阵一定可以化为对角矩阵。

2、相似对角化是指将原矩阵化为对角矩阵,且对角矩阵对角线上的每个元素都是原矩阵的特征值。

如果化成的是单位矩阵(特殊的对角矩阵,对角线全为1)的话,就是第一行的第一个要变成1,就把其他的行的第一个全化成零,也就是用其他行的第一个数加上 或者减去k倍的第一行的第一个数,记住 要把谁化成0就是该行减去或加上不要求变的那一行。

如果第一行的第一个数不是1,可以把第一行同时除以一个数,使第一个数变成1。不知道你能不能明白。。

matlab如何将普通矩阵转化为正互反

在MATLAB中,可以使用以下步骤将一个普通矩阵转化为正定对称互反矩阵:

计算矩阵的转置矩阵。

计算矩阵和其转置矩阵的乘积。

对乘积矩阵进行特征值分解,得到特征值和特征向量。

将特征值中小于等于0的部分替换为一个较小的正数,例如1e-6。

将特征值构成对角矩阵,特征向量构成正交矩阵。

将特征值对角矩阵和特征向量正交矩阵相乘,得到正定对称互反矩阵。

下面是MATLAB代码示例:

% 假设A是一个普通矩阵

到此,以上就是小编对于矩阵函数变换的问题就介绍到这了,希望介绍的3点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。

随机图文
    此处不必修改,程序自动调用!
  • 随机文章

  • 热门文章

  • 热评文章

sql语句自动生成(sql语句自动生成器)
2025-06-16  阅读(574)
  • B函数求解(函数b的求法)
    2025-06-18  阅读(498)
  • 周期函数,周函数的使用方法
    2025-06-15  阅读(623)
  • 用第三个表达式替换第一个字符串表达式中出现的所有第二个给定字符串表达式。

    语法

    REPLACE ( ''string_replace1'' , ''string_replace2'' , ''string_replace3'' )

    参数

    SqlServer中REPLACE函数的使用,sql替换字符串函数

    ''string_replace1''

    待搜索的字符串表达式。string_replace1 可以是字符数据或二进制数据。

    ''string_replace2''

    待查找的字符串表达式。string_replace2 可以是字符数据或二进制数据。

    SqlServer中REPLACE函数的使用,sql替换字符串函数

    在SQL Server中,REPLACE函数用于替换字符串中出现的指定子字符串。它接受三个参数:原字符串,要被替换的子字符串和替换后的子字符串。

    该函数会查找原字符串中的所有匹配项,并将其替换为指定的字符串。如果原字符串中不存在要替换的子字符串,则不会发生任何更改。使用REPLACE函数可以轻松地进行字符串替换操作,例如将某些特定字符替换为其他字符或将一部分文本替换为其他文本。这在数据清洗和字符串处理中非常有用。

    sourceinsight怎么替换字符串

    12。replace('string" class="zf_thumb" width="48" height="48" title="SqlServer中REPLACE函数的使用,sql替换字符串函数" />

  • SqlServer中REPLACE函数的使用,sql替换字符串函数
    2025-06-15  阅读(559)
  • 一个已知的函数有几个原函数,任意原函数之间的差值是
    2025-06-15  阅读(486)
  • sql server新建表(sql如何新建数据库)
    2025-06-18  阅读(487)
  • 数行函数(数行数的函数)
    2025-06-16  阅读(499)
  • mysql数据库,指定到某一时间,它就自动执行相应的操作?sql语句该怎么写,定时执行sql语句设置
    2025-06-15  阅读(593)
  • 最新留言